1/8 3.5mm Monoconductor Cable - Copper Conductor, PP Insulation - China Suppliers & Factory
| Construction | ||
| Copper Construction | 7*0.21 mm | 7*0.0082" |
| Insulation (PP) | 1.71 mm | 0.0673" |
| Number and Size of Wires | ||
| Inner Armor | 12*0.47 mm | 12*0.0185" |
| Outer Armor | 18*0.47 mm | 18*0.0185" |
| Average Wire Breaking Strength | ||
| Inner Armor | 324 N | 72.8 lbs |
| Outer Armor | 324 N | 72.8 lbs |
| Physical | ||
| Cable Diameter | 3.5 mm +0.13 mm / -0.05 mm | 0.1380" +0.0051" / -0.0019" |
| Cable Weight in Air | 45 kg/km | 30 lbs/kft |
| 1 hr. Max Temp | 150 ℃ | 300 °F |
| 8 hr. Max Temp | 135 ℃ | 275 °F |
| Cont. Max Temp | 121 ℃ | 250 °F |
| Mechanical | ||
| Cable Breaking Strength | 8 kN | 1800 lbs |
| Maximum Suggested Working Tension | 4 kN | 900 lbs |
| Minimum Shave Diameter | 190 mm | 7.5" |
| Cable Stretch Coefficient | 7.3 m/km/5kN | 6.5 ft/kft/klbs |
| Electrical | ||
| Voltage Rating | 300 VDC | 300 VDC |
| Insulation Resistance | 15000 MΩ·km | 50000 MΩ·kft |
| Resistance Typical @ 20 ℃ | 75 Ω/km | 22.8 Ω/kft |
| Capacitance @ 1kHz | 140 pF/m | 43 pF/ft |

Frequently Asked Questions
Q
What is the maximum continuous operating temperature of this cable?
The cable supports a continuous maximum temperature of 121 ℃ (250 °F). For short-duration operations, it can withstand up to 135 ℃ (275 °F) for 8 hours and 150 ℃ (300 °F) for 1 hour.
Q
What is the cable breaking strength and recommended working tension?
The cable breaking strength is 8 kN (1800 lbs). The maximum suggested working tension is 4 kN (900 lbs), which is 50% of the breaking strength to ensure safe and reliable operation.
Q
What voltage rating does this cable support?
This cable is rated at 300 VDC, making it suitable for downhole and wireline logging applications that require stable low-voltage DC power transmission.
Q
What are the inner and outer armor construction specifications?
The inner armor consists of 12 wires × 0.47 mm (0.0185") and the outer armor consists of 18 wires × 0.47 mm (0.0185"). Both inner and outer armor have an average wire breaking strength of 324 N (72.8 lbs).
Q
What is the insulation resistance of the cable?
The cable offers an exceptionally high insulation resistance of 15,000 MΩ·km (50,000 MΩ·kft), ensuring excellent electrical isolation and reliable signal transmission in harsh downhole environments.
Q
What is the minimum sheave diameter recommended for this cable?
The minimum sheave (pulley) diameter recommended for this cable is 190 mm (7.5"). Using a sheave smaller than this may cause excessive bending stress and could damage the armor or conductor over time.
